2006 New Mexico Bowl

The 2006 New Mexico Bowl was a post-season American college football bowl game held on December 23, 2006 at University Stadium on the University of New Mexico campus in Albuquerque as part of the 2006-07 NCAA bowl season. The game, telecast on ESPN, featured the San Jose State Spartans from the WAC and the hometown New Mexico Lobos from the Mountain West Conference. The game was the inaugural New Mexico Bowl and the first bowl game held in the state.

San Jose State controlled the action all game long, jumping out to a 20-3 lead before New Mexico tacked on 9 points in the final few minutes. Spartan quarterback Adam Tafralis threw three touchdown passes, two to offensive MVP James Jones, in a dominant performance. With the loss, New Mexico's postseason drought was extended to 45 years.
